  • Calculation form: Division - Quotient and remainder

    This calculation of shape is possible?

    Between dividend in the to field user > user between divider in domain B > C field calculates the quotient > field D calculates the rest

    example 1: 100 ÷ B25 = C4 D0

    example 2: A90 ÷ B25 = C3 D15

    Of course, the only thing is to check that the divider is not empty or null, as the division by zero is not allowed.

    Basically, the C field calculation script can be something like this:

    var a = number (this.getField("Field_A").value).

    var b = number (this.getField("Field_B").value);

    If (b == 0) event.value = "";

    else event.value = Math.floor (a/b);

    Field D using the same code but replace the last line with:

    else event.value = (a and b %);

  • Calculation form does not work in some readers/computers

    Hello!

    This is a weird problem: I have this form where to place three numeric fields, two of them for the user to fill out, one-third to calculate the sum of the previous ones.

    I use this FormCalc expression:

    this.rawValue = bobina1.rawValue + bobina2.rawValue

    Well, it works... but only on some machines.

    During the audit, the team found it could be solved by activating JavaScript... but still it doesn´t work on readers Acrobat version 9.3 or below.

    When you try this with the version of readers 9.4 it worked, but still had to do the activation of JavaScript.

    Issues related to the:

    Is there a way to activate JavaScript automatically once a PDF is open?  How?

    OR

    is there a way to activate JavaScript in Reader version 9.4 and especially automatically during the installation?

    Thank you very much!

    Marcos

    Hello

    to run scripts in forms, you will still need to activate JavaScript, no matter if the form uses JavaScript or FormCalc.

    This setting cannot be done via scripts, only by users or admin.

    If Acrobat/Reader detects scriptings in a form, it should generally notify users (yellow bar) and ask him to aktivate.

  • Many forms, even calculations-in any way to expedite the creation of each shape

    I create many forms in adobe pro 9 with the same calculations.  Each form when to convert word to PDF from adobe has only a few calculations.  I have attatched an example, but it's basically height x weight gives you BSA.  BSA x dose/m2 = dose patients.  All forms with have the same calculation, just different drugs.  Someone at - it a way to speed up the creation of forms of ~ 100. =)

    Thanks, Chris

    You can cut paste between Forms and calculations form fields will be copied on.

    You could also write the calculations as a function of document level that has the necessary values to pass as a parameter to the function, and the function returns the result of the calculation. You can insert a form that has these document in another form-level functions and features become functions of the new form document level and you can then delete the inserted pages and keep level document functions.

    The document function could be:

    function {BSA (nHeight, nWeight)
    calculate the index of BSA
    nHeight = Number (nHeight);
    nWeight = Number (nWeight);
    return Math.sqrt ((nHeight * nWeight) / 3600);
    } / / end of function of BSA

    The calculation for the 'low' field could then be:

    Event.Value = BSA (this.getField("height").value, this.getField("weight").value);

  • Question form: How to get the percentage calculated?

    Hello!

    I have a form that is a Bill as form. I can't get the front total tax, then plug the percentage tax amount (it varies depending on the County, so it cannot be a static number), then adding total before tax plus taxes. HOWEVER, I also need to know what total percentage tax is in the form of $.

    For example:

    BOX A - Total before taxes: $10.00 (calculated by the form of the total above form)

    BOX B - percentage of the tax: 10% (filled by the user)

    BOX C - Total AMOUNT: $ 11.00 (calculated from above)

    What I need too, is:

    BOX - total tax: $1

    Its final form:

    BOX A - Total before taxes: $10.00

    BOX B - percentage of the tax: 10%

    BOX C - total taxes: $1

    AREA D - Total AMOUNT: $ 11.00

    Thank you!

    Is box B a real percentage field, or is it just a body of numbers?

    If the first case, as the custom calculation of box C script enter:

    Event.Value = number (this.getField("Box_A").value) * number (this.getField("Box_B").value).

    If it's the latter, then copy the following code:

    Event.Value = number (this.getField("Box_A").value) * (number (this.getField("Box_B").value) / 100);

    Then set the calculation of the D box as being the sum of area A and area C.

  • editing custom and calculations of form fields?

    On my excel spreadsheet report I follow the progress of the construction in linear feet of number from one station to the other.   Numbers station expressed exactly as with decimal places except the decimal point is replaced by the sign ' + '.  So if we type inOn my excellent spreadsheet report I follow the progress of the construction in linear feet of number from one station to the other.   Numbers station expressed exactly as with decimal places except the decimal point is replaced by the sign ' + '.  So, if we're typing in 200, it becomes 2 + 00 (which means station # 200... either 200 feet from the starting point of 0 + 00) it's really easy game this place in excel through shaped custom and isn't able to subtract effect station # else automatically calculates the daily footages.   How can I go to learn how to implement in the acrobat form fields?  Thank you

    OK, you can use the following script to custom size for a text field:

    Custom Format script for the text field

    If {(event.value)

    (Event.Value = util.printf("%.2f", event.value / 100) .replace (".", "+");

    }

    This can be expressed in plain language with: If the field is not empty, divide the value by 100, round off the result to the tenth closest and replace the comma with a sign more.

    A script format is used to change what is displayed in the field the value of the underlying field leaving unaltered, so the value of the field can be used in normal numeric calculations.

  • 11 GR 2 forms: display windows calculator on before calling the form?

    I called the windows calculator in my forms through

    AppID: = DDE. App_Begin ('C:\Windows\system32\calc.exe', DDE. APP_MODE_MAXIMIZED);

    DDE. App_Focus (appid);

    which trigger key, but when I press the button the calculator is displayed but not active, I want the calculator should display on the front of my form (call the adapted form).

    I use forms GR 11, 2.

    As mentioned Amatu, what you do will not work as expected when you deploy your application in a production facility.  I suspect that you run the form directly from the form Builder on your local computer.

    To display a calculator to an end user, you'll either need add WebUtil to your application and use the Windows calculator or calculator Java Bean.  The Java Bean option is probably a better because with it, you can actually have the value in the calculator sent to the form.  The disadvantage of the use of a Java Bean, it's that you have to design it.  There are some great examples here:

    http://Forms.PJC.Bean.over-blog.com/article-35505095.html

    With WebUtil, the call might look like this:

    WEBUTIL_HOST. HOST ('calc');

    There is also a non-blocking option which allows the user to have both the open Calculator and still have access to the form.  Using the above, the form will be locked until the calculator is closed.  Refer to the manufacturer for more information about WebUtil, duties and requirements.
